What I Saw in California

What I Saw in California

Literature

5.0

First published in 1848, What I Saw in California has long been recognized as the foremost trail guide for the Forty-niners. The Great War As I Saw It

The Great War As I Saw It

Young Adult

5.0

A fifty-three-year-old Anglican priest and poet when the First World War broke out, Frederick George Scott was an improbable volunteer, but also an invaluable war memoirist about life at the front.
